- MarcinPoznan, Poland50 contributionsGreat support and hospitality! We were on holiday in Kenya and when it goes to kitesurfing we choose Kitemotion team to hot us.
The place, the beach boys, the support and flexibility to choose the right package of trainings was great.
Agnieszka and the trainers explained in details the whole spot, when there is a best time during the day to kite etc.
The only thing you should be aware of id the fact that in Kenya all beaches are public, so no special places to start and land are designated... but Kitemotion beach boys helped us all time!
Thanks, hope to be there again soon!
